怎么让mocha支持ES6模块
发表于:2025-11-13 作者:千家信息网编辑
千家信息网最后更新 2025年11月13日,今天小编给大家分享一下怎么让mocha支持ES6模块的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起
千家信息网最后更新 2025年11月13日怎么让mocha支持ES6模块
今天小编给大家分享一下怎么让mocha支持ES6模块的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。
mocha是比较常用的node测试框架,但是只支持commonjs模块,要让mocha支持ES6模块,需要babel的帮助。
书写本文时用到的工具版本为:
babel v7mocha v6.2
安装依赖
$ npm i -D @babel/cli @babel/core @babel/preset-env @babel/register
babel配置
在package.json或.babelrc中添加配置:
{ "presets": ["@babel/preset-env"]}// "babel": {// "presets": [// "@babel/preset-env"// ]// }
配置命令
最后配置运行命令,babel/register会绑定到node的require模块,代码运行时会实施转译,这样就可以支持ES6的模块语法了:
"scripts": { "test": "mocha --require @babel/register test/*.js",}
以上就是"怎么让mocha支持ES6模块"这篇文章的所有内容,感谢各位的阅读!相信大家阅读完这篇文章都有很大的收获,小编每天都会为大家更新不同的知识,如果还想学习更多的知识,请关注行业资讯频道。
模块
支持
知识
篇文章
配置
内容
命令
运行
不同
很大
代码
大部分
就是
工具
常用
更多
框架
版本
知识点
行业
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
网络运维服务器价格
net 获取数据库名
绍兴易新网络技术公司
mysql获取数据库名
北京网络安全管理系统
政府网络安全问题及解决方案
南京点橙互联网科技面试题
长沙软件开发定制费用
有线网络技术人员工作总结
如何启动服务器上的代理
饥荒联机版服务器的mod修改
计算机网络技术招聘要求
映美讯机顶盒改服务器
目录服务器的作用是什么
网络安全法是公法
sql数据库数据表中删除数据
重庆网络安全局局标
长征数据库书籍
网络安全的责任定义
vb如何打印数据库中的内容
数据库表中存的网址怎么访问的
vba获取数据库字段名称
青岛耀星网络技术公司招聘
饥荒联机版服务器的mod修改
杭州网络技术大赛
求生之路2建房选什么服务器不卡
天津纺织外贸软件开发公司
福州网络安全有限公司
个人数据库快速开发
医疗软件开发目的模板